✦ Synopsis
Photodarkening relaxation under light exposure of a-As 2 Se 3 amorphous films doped with 0.5 at.% of metals Sn, Mn, Sm or Dy and a-AsSe films doped with Sn up to 10.0 at.% Sn was studied in dependence on the impurity and thermal treating. Both factors reduce photodarkening and the degree of reduction depends on the type of impurity. The relaxation process may be described by a stretched exponential with the dispersion parameter 0.4 a < 1 and time constant increasing with embedding of impurity or thermal annealing. The results are discussed in the frame of the recently forwarded ``slip-motionº model of photodarkening in chalcogenide glasses.
